Requirements
  • 3-5+ years’ experience in benefits including a strong knowledge of self-insured plans, ancillary lines, and current legislation
  • Bachelor’s degree (or its equivalent) highly preferred
  • Georgia Life and Health license is required or willing to complete ASAP
  • Professional Designations (RHU, REBC, CEBS) a plus
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ills
  • Ability to interact effectively with people of various responsibility and authority (employees, key contacts, executives, etc.).
  • Highly organized.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and projects at once
Responsibilities
  • Consulting – understands key business issues for clients and the role Benefits play in their business & articulates long-term benefit goals & develops strategic plan to achieve them.
  • Educate, support & becomes a trusted advisor to each client
  • Address client problems and issues, understands expectations & consistently meet through viable solutions. Acts proactively when potential issue is uncovered
  • Strategically plans and executes plan renewals, staying in regular communication with the clients and updating them on various emerging trends and solutions for their business needs. Anticipates concerns developing from the renewal process.
  • Understands thoroughly and stays abreast of changes in employee benefits, including plan designs, available riders, legislation, and emerging trends.
  • Attends training opportunities, reads and shares industry knowledge, regularly participates in coursework to either earn or maintain professional designations.
  • Alerts client to potential issues (legislative and coverage information). Provides and explains compliance package annually.
  • Shadows other consultants in the field periodically to study other business segments, techniques, and consulting styles. Invites other consultants to shadow his appointments.
  • Meets regularly (at least 2x/year) with medical and ancillary carrier reps to get updates on the latest innovations and strategies. Fosters a good professional relationship with carrier reps by meeting with them and by providing feedback on their quotes.
  • Conducts client presentations in a consultative (logical, professional and informative) manner. Encourages feedback from the client and projects confidence
  • Assesses cross selling opportunities with all clients. Encourages client to be innovative. Involves Voluntary Consultant and Financial Representative as appropriate. Asks client for referrals and generates new sales opportunities.
  • Discusses strategic partnerships with client, including ADP, Chase, Carrier Wellness offerings, COBRA administration, FSA administration, etc.
  • Discusses compensation and value proposition with client. Discusses compensation adjustment when necessary.
  • Strives for 100% client retention
  • Provides accurate and timely client deliverables according to Performance Standards. Reviews all presentation material thoroughly well in advance of meeting and checks to ensure there are no errors and that content is pertinent and practical. Ensures that follow up issues are handled timely and communicated to client.
  • Makes use of and offers to clients HUB Value Added Services, including Benefit Summaries, Mywave (20+), POP plans, Wellness Communications Plans, Hope Health newsletters, etc.
  • Builds and maintains strong relationship with client HR and Benefits staff and upper management through regular communication
  • Proactively reaches out on a regular basis.
  • Acts as a mentor for the Associate Benefit Consultant, Account Manager, BA/CSS and ISR. Assists in growth and development through constant communication and instruction. Delegates appropriately, set expectations and hold members accountable.
  • Holds regular team meetings. Keeps team informed and communicates thoroughly and clearly with all team members concerning client issues, renewals, and proactive work. Positively influences the team members; uses the HUB Essential 7 effectively to mediate concerns, offer encouragement and praise, promote engagement, and build good working relationships.
  • Uses Benefit Point to document and assign all client service issues and key steps in the renewal process
  • Ensures that the implementation and transition processes for all carrier changes are handled smoothly with minimal disruption. Communicates and documents major issues and changes. Stays on top on “next steps”. Ensures that submission and all applicable documents are processed accurately and timely.
  • Proactively checks and verifies all information (new rates, employee enrollments and changes, ID cards, etc.). Promptly addresses and solves problems generated through the renewal process.
  • Is prepared, organized, and methodical. Has a system for tracking and managing the various issues and projects that are in process.

HUB provides advisory services to businesses and individuals, helping them achieve their goals through a comprehensive range of insurance and risk management solutions. Their offerings include property and casualty insurance, life and health insurance, employee benefits, retirement planning, and wealth management. HUB operates through a network of specialists who work closely with clients to create customized solutions that address their specific needs. What sets HUB apart from its competitors is their focus on advocacy and personalized service, ensuring that clients receive dedicated support and guidance. The company's goal is to empower clients with the knowledge and resources they need to navigate a changing world and prepare for the future.

Hub International Launches Private Client Small Business Solutions

Critical Consultative Guidance and Solutions to Help Affluent Clients Secure Insurance Coverage and Mitigate Risks When Operating a Side VentureCHICAGO, April 22,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Hub International Limited (HUB), a leading global insurance brokerage and financial services firm, announced today the launch of HUB Private Client Small Business Solutions. The new offering provides high-net-worth (HNW) clients access to specialized coverages to address the risks and liabilities involved with launching and owning a small business.High-net-worth entrepreneurs are navigating a dynamic landscape of record new business formation and an increase of side-business activity as they pursue their next passion. The U.S. Small Business Administration reports a record of 5.5 million new business applications were filed in 2023. As high-net-worth entrepreneurs face the same economic uncertainty and emerging risks that any small business owner might face, they require specialized insurance coverage and risk advisory services that safeguard their ventures and wealth as they launch anything from their new tequila line to jewelry designs."When an affluent family member starts a side venture, they need to understand and account for liabilities while operating a small business," said Katherine Frattarola, HUB Executive Vice President and Head of HUB Private Client. "With HUB Private Client Small Business Solutions, we understand the importance of customized guidance and solutions to protect not just the operations of this new venture but our clients' wealth and legacy."HUB Private Client Small Business Solutions is powered by Insureon, HUB's digital marketplace for small business insurance, which provides convenient digital access to specialized coverages from more than 30 leading insurance carriers, including general liability, commercial auto, property, business owners, cyber, errors and omissions, and more

Hub International Strengthens Employee Benefits Services With Acquisition Of Employee Benefit Associates, Inc. In Kentucky

CHICAGO, April 8,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Hub International Limited (Hub), a leading global insurance brokerage and financial services firm, announced today that it has acquired the assets of Employee Benefit Associates, Inc. (EBA). Terms of the transaction were not disclosed.EBA is an independent insurance agency located in Lexington, Kentucky. EBA provides clients in the region with employee benefit planning with additional services, including individual life and health coverages."We're excited EBA is joining Hub, which is another milestone for our region's strategic growth," said Cooper Jones, President of Hub Mid-South. "EBA will help strengthen our ability to provide sophisticated counsel to our clients navigating today's evolving employee benefits landscape."Benefit Consultants Greg Humkey and Christina Heckathorn, and the EBA team will join Hub Mid-South.EBA will be referred to as EBA, a Hub International company.About Hub's M&A ActivitiesHub International Limited is committed to growing organically and through acquisitions to expand its geographic footprint and strengthen industry and product expertise.
